Evan Bell | Prep Girls Hoops Scout
Mallory put her multidimensional talent on full display at the P2W Headliners Invitational Showcase. She anticipated backdoor cuts on defense during drills, deflected entry passes, and absorbed contact to score a nice finish with her left hand on a drive. In games, Mallory continued to play well for Team Liberty. She penetrated gaps with her dribble and fired accurate kickout passes to open teammates on the perimeter. Mallory shot the ball confidently from beyond the arc with good balance off the catch or the bounce. She has deep range and buried back-to-back triples up top off the dribble, then drilled another from the wing after a kick out. Mallory moved quickly laterally to cut off drives and made a noticeable impact with her scrappy defense. She kept her eyes up to find open teammates while pushing the ball with both hands in transition, and looked comfortable running the one or the two.

Mallory is a guard who caught my eye on the court last fall, and I’m excited to see her again at the Headliners Invitational Showcase on Sunday. She excelled for Groves as a freshman, putting up huge numbers in their high-octane, run-and-gun offense. Mallory averaged 13.3 points, 4.9 rebounds, 3.2 assists, and 2.9 steals per game. She made an eye-popping 69 threes and earned OAA White All-League honors. Mallory made 30.9% of her attempts from beyond the arc and a very efficient 56% from 2PT.
